Juvenile Case Plan (.docx) HOT. WebbA case plan provides a road map for supervising and , addressing probationer’s needs structuring activities, and prioritizing goals. Case plans are dynamic and focus on addressing criminogenic needs. The plan documents activities that the probationer must complete as a case condition of probation. Webb“Case plan” means the documented supervision strategy developed by the supervising probation officer which clearly identifies the risk factors and needs of the probationer and how they will be addressed. “Case record” means any record pertaining to a particular probationer maintained by the probation department in electronic or paper medium.
